Description
Brouwer - eigenaar Luc Vermeersch heeft een grote interesse voor traditionele ambachten. Niet vreemd dus dat hij destijds in zijn tuinhuis een broodoven en kleine brouwerij heeft geïnstalleerd. De minibrouwerij van 30 liter had hij in 1997 in Finland gekocht. Hij kreeg van de fabrikant juist geteld één weekend opleiding. Door veel zelfstudie en het maken van talloze kleine proefbrouwsels groeide zijn brouwkennis en -interesse. Na 10 jaar brouwen schreef hij zich in voor een brouwcursus. Tijdens het cursusjaar smeedde hij plannen voor een grotere brouwerij en begon hij her en der delen van de installatie te kopen. In april 2008 was brouwerij De Leite een feit.
